site stats

Buddy system in memory management

WebSr. Manager - Embedded & System Software. Bisquare Systems Pvt. Ltd. Apr 2011 - Jul 20132 years 4 months. NOIDA. • RTOS Firmware Design, implementation and debugging. • Device Drivers - requirements, design, develop, release and team lead. • Product management Techno-commercial proposals, vendors or clients interaction. http://www.patentbuddy.com/Patent/20240104964

DISTRIBUTED SYSTEM WORKLOAD MANAGEMENT VIA NODE …

WebDec 20, 2024 · Buddy system algorithm is dynamic memory control which is usually embedded in the memory management unit, which is a part of the most widely use modern operating systems. Dynamic memory... WebA buddy system can work very well or very badly, depending on how the chosen sizes interact with typical requests for memory and what the pattern of returned blocks is. ... To provide memory management services that the system memory manager does not supply. In general, suballocators are less efficient than having a single memory manager … jello pudding mix nutrition https://clarionanddivine.com

What is Buddy System - javatpoint

http://www.patentbuddy.com/Patent/20240072962 http://cs.boisestate.edu/~amit/teaching/453/handouts/memory-management-handout.pdf WebA Buddy System is memory management and allocation algorithm that divides memory into the power of two and tries to satisfy a memory request as suitable as possible. It uses memory into halves to try to give the best fit. Assume the size of memory is 2 m and the size of the process is P. laidong km385

Buddy System Allocator in Operating System Prepinsta

Category:OPERATING SYSTEMS MEMORY MANAGEMENT - WPI

Tags:Buddy system in memory management

Buddy system in memory management

Partition Allocation Methods in Memory Management

WebA computer-implemented method, a computer program product, and a computer system for data flow management in a heterogeneous memory device. Trigger Patent Buddy

Buddy system in memory management

Did you know?

WebMemory managementis a form of resource managementapplied to computer memory. The essential requirement of memory management is to provide ways to dynamically … The buddy memory allocation technique is a memory allocation algorithm that divides memory into partitions to try to satisfy a memory request as suitably as possible. This system makes use of splitting memory into halves to try to give a best fit. According to Donald Knuth, the buddy system was invented in 1963 by Harry Markowitz, and was first described by Kenneth C. Knowlton (published 1965). The Buddy memory allocation is relatively easy to implement. It supports limit…

WebMemory Management with Bitmaps: When memory is assigned dynamically, the operating system must manage it. With a bitmap, memory ... In a buddy system, the entire memory space available for allocation is initially treated as a single block whose size is a power of 2. When the first request is made, if its size is greater than half of the initial WebDec 20, 2024 · Buddy system algorithm is dynamic memory control which is usually embedded in the memory management unit, which is a part of the most widely use modern operating systems. Dynamic memory …

WebApr 14, 2015 · Buddy Memory Allocation system 1. Presented By: Kumod Shah Roll no. 14 2. The buddy memory allocation technique is a memory allocation algorithm that divides memory into partitions to try to satisfy a … WebJan 20, 2024 · In a buddy system, the entire memory space available for allocation is treated as a single block whose size is a power of 2. Suppose that the size of memory is 2U and the requirement is of size S. Allocation can happen if –. If 2U-1<=2U: is satisfied else. Recursively divide the block equally and test the condition at each time, when it ...

http://www.patentbuddy.com/Patent/11567668

WebApr 6, 2024 · Figure 7-2. Data structures used by the buddy system. Figure 7-2. Data structures used by the buddy system. 7.1.7.2 Allocating a block. The alloc_pages( ) function is the core of the buddy system allocation … lai dosing chartWebPutting the Buddy System into Action Deploy in 2-person teams (minimum). • Get to know your buddy’s background, prior experience, and job role (especially if different from your own). • Stay close to your buddy and communicate regularly, especially when traveling in-country. Look out for hazardous conditions, safety demands, and stressors ... laidouni pes databaseWebFeb 26, 2024 · In the operating system, the following are four common memory management techniques. Single contiguous allocation: Simplest allocation method used … laidouni transfermarktWebThe Buddy System (Knuth, 1973; Knowlton, 1965) is a memory allocation technique that works on the basis of using binary numbers as these are fast for computers to manipulate. This is how the buddy system works. Lists are maintained which store lists of free memory blocks of sizes 1, 2, 4, 8,…, n, where n is the size of the memory (in bytes). ... lai dosingWebMar 8, 2024 · Buddy allocation system is an algorithm in which a larger memory block is divided into small parts to satisfy the request. This … jello pudding no sugar addedWebApr 24, 2024 · The buddy system is a memory allocation and management algorithm that manages memory in power of two increments. For instance, if we have a memory of … jello pudding mix flavorsWebDec 11, 2013 · Simple implementation of a buddy system for memory management. - GitHub - lotabout/buddy-system: Simple implementation of a buddy system for memory management. laidouni ahmed